|
14 | 14 | <category citation-format="note"/>
|
15 | 15 | <category field="law"/>
|
16 | 16 | <summary>Masaryk University, Faculty of Law</summary>
|
17 |
| - <updated>2020-04-18T10:00:00+00:00</updated> |
| 17 | + <updated>2020-05-14T10:00:00+00:00</updated> |
18 | 18 | <rights license="http://creativecommons.org/licenses/by-sa/3.0/">This work is licensed under a Creative Commons Attribution-ShareAlike 3.0 License</rights>
|
19 | 19 | </info>
|
20 | 20 | <locale xml:lang="cs">
|
21 | 21 | <terms>
|
22 | 22 | <term name="accessed" form="short">cit.</term>
|
23 | 23 | <term name="editor" form="short">
|
24 | 24 | <single>ed.</single>
|
25 |
| - <multiple>eds.</multiple> |
| 25 | + <multiple>eds</multiple> |
26 | 26 | </term>
|
27 | 27 | </terms>
|
28 | 28 | </locale>
|
|
44 | 44 | <choose>
|
45 | 45 | <if variable="author">
|
46 | 46 | <names variable="author">
|
47 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 47 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
48 | 48 | <name-part name="family" text-case="capitalize-first"/>
|
49 | 49 | </name>
|
50 | 50 | </names>
|
51 | 51 | </if>
|
52 | 52 | <else-if variable="editor">
|
53 | 53 | <names variable="editor">
|
54 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 54 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
55 | 55 | <name-part name="family" text-case="capitalize-first"/>
|
56 | 56 | </name>
|
57 | 57 | <label prefix=" (" form="short" plural="contextual" suffix=")."/>
|
|
63 | 63 | <choose>
|
64 | 64 | <if variable="author">
|
65 | 65 | <names variable="author">
|
66 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 66 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
67 | 67 | <name-part name="family" text-case="capitalize-first"/>
|
68 | 68 | </name>
|
69 | 69 | </names>
|
70 | 70 | </if>
|
71 | 71 | <else-if variable="editor">
|
72 | 72 | <names variable="editor">
|
73 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 73 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
74 | 74 | <name-part name="family" text-case="capitalize-first"/>
|
75 | 75 | </name>
|
76 | 76 | <label prefix=" (" form="short" plural="contextual" suffix=")."/>
|
|
82 | 82 | <choose>
|
83 | 83 | <if variable="author">
|
84 | 84 | <names variable="author">
|
85 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". " form="short"> |
| 85 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". " form="short"> |
86 | 86 | <name-part name="family" text-case="capitalize-first"/>
|
87 | 87 | </name>
|
88 | 88 | </names>
|
89 | 89 | </if>
|
90 | 90 | <else-if variable="editor">
|
91 | 91 | <names variable="editor">
|
92 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 92 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
93 | 93 | <name-part name="family" text-case="capitalize-first"/>
|
94 | 94 | </name>
|
95 | 95 | <label prefix=" (" form="short" plural="contextual" suffix=")."/>
|
|
113 | 113 | <choose>
|
114 | 114 | <if variable="container-author">
|
115 | 115 | <names variable="container-author">
|
116 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 116 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
117 | 117 | <name-part name="family" text-case="capitalize-first"/>
|
118 | 118 | </name>
|
119 | 119 | </names>
|
|
122 | 122 | <choose>
|
123 | 123 | <if type="chapter paper-conference" match="any">
|
124 | 124 | <names variable="editor">
|
125 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 125 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
126 | 126 | <name-part name="family" text-case="capitalize-first"/>
|
127 | 127 | </name>
|
128 | 128 | <label prefix=" (" form="short" plural="contextual" suffix=")."/>
|
|
136 | 136 | <choose>
|
137 | 137 | <if variable="container-author">
|
138 | 138 | <names variable="container-author">
|
139 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 139 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
140 | 140 | <name-part name="family" text-case="capitalize-first"/>
|
141 | 141 | </name>
|
142 | 142 | </names>
|
|
145 | 145 | <choose>
|
146 | 146 | <if type="chapter paper-conference" match="any">
|
147 | 147 | <names variable="editor">
|
148 |
| - <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
| 148 | + <name name-as-sort-order="all" sort-separator=", " delimiter=", " initialize-with=". "> |
149 | 149 | <name-part name="family" text-case="capitalize-first"/>
|
150 | 150 | </name>
|
151 | 151 | <label prefix=" (" form="short" plural="contextual" suffix=")."/>
|
|
237 | 237 | <macro name="publisher-place">
|
238 | 238 | <group delimiter="; ">
|
239 | 239 | <choose>
|
240 |
| - <if variable="publisher-place accessed DOI URL" match="any"> |
| 240 | + <if variable="publisher-place URL" match="any"> |
241 | 241 | <text variable="publisher-place"/>
|
242 | 242 | </if>
|
243 | 243 | </choose>
|
|
246 | 246 | <macro name="printers">
|
247 | 247 | <group delimiter="; ">
|
248 | 248 | <choose>
|
249 |
| - <if variable="publisher accessed DOI URL" match="any"> |
| 249 | + <if variable="publisher URL" match="any"> |
250 | 250 | <text variable="publisher"/>
|
251 | 251 | </if>
|
252 | 252 | </choose>
|
|
258 | 258 | <text macro="printers"/>
|
259 | 259 | </group>
|
260 | 260 | </macro>
|
| 261 | + <macro name="issued-year"> |
| 262 | + <date variable="issued"> |
| 263 | + <date-part name="year"/> |
| 264 | + </date> |
| 265 | + </macro> |
261 | 266 | <macro name="issued">
|
262 | 267 | <choose>
|
263 | 268 | <if type="article-journal article-magazine article-newspaper" match="any">
|
264 |
| - <date variable="issued"> |
265 |
| - <date-part name="year" range-delimiter="–"/> |
266 |
| - </date> |
267 | 269 | <choose>
|
268 |
| - <if variable="volume"> |
269 |
| - <text prefix=", " term="volume" form="short" suffix=". "/> |
270 |
| - <text variable="volume"/> |
| 270 | + <if variable="issued" match="any"> |
| 271 | + <date variable="issued"> |
| 272 | + <date-part name="year" range-delimiter="–"/> |
| 273 | + </date> |
271 | 274 | </if>
|
| 275 | + <else> |
| 276 | + <choose> |
| 277 | + <if variable="volume"> |
| 278 | + <text term="volume" form="short" suffix=" "/> |
| 279 | + <text variable="volume"/> |
| 280 | + </if> |
| 281 | + </choose> |
| 282 | + </else> |
272 | 283 | </choose>
|
273 | 284 | <choose>
|
274 | 285 | <if variable="issue">
|
275 |
| - <text prefix=", " term="issue" form="short" suffix=". "/> |
| 286 | + <text prefix=", " term="issue" form="short" suffix=" "/> |
276 | 287 | <text variable="issue"/>
|
277 | 288 | </if>
|
278 | 289 | </choose>
|
279 | 290 | </if>
|
280 | 291 | <else-if type="webpage" match="any">
|
281 | 292 | <date variable="issued">
|
282 |
| - <date-part name="day" suffix=". "/> |
283 |
| - <date-part name="month" suffix=". " form="numeric"/> |
| 293 | + <date-part name="day" suffix=". "/> |
| 294 | + <date-part name="month" suffix=". " form="numeric"/> |
284 | 295 | <date-part name="year"/>
|
285 | 296 | </date>
|
286 | 297 | </else-if>
|
|
298 | 309 | </choose>
|
299 | 310 | </macro>
|
300 | 311 | <macro name="citation-locator">
|
301 |
| - <label variable="locator" form="short" suffix=". "/> |
| 312 | + <label variable="locator" form="short" suffix=" "/> |
302 | 313 | <text variable="locator"/>
|
303 | 314 | </macro>
|
304 | 315 | <macro name="collection">
|
|
313 | 324 | <macro name="identifier">
|
314 | 325 | <group delimiter="; ">
|
315 | 326 | <choose>
|
316 |
| - <if variable="DOI"> |
317 |
| - <text variable="DOI" prefix="doi: "/> |
| 327 | + <if variable="URL"> |
| 328 | + <text variable="URL"/> |
318 | 329 | </if>
|
319 |
| - <else> |
320 |
| - <text variable="URL" prefix=""/> |
321 |
| - </else> |
322 | 330 | </choose>
|
323 | 331 | </group>
|
324 | 332 | </macro>
|
325 | 333 | <macro name="medium">
|
326 | 334 | <choose>
|
327 |
| - <if variable="accessed DOI URL" match="any"> |
328 |
| - <text term="online" prefix="[" suffix="]"/> |
| 335 | + <if variable="URL" match="any"> |
| 336 | + <choose> |
| 337 | + <if type="webpage"> |
| 338 | + <text term="online" prefix="[" suffix="]"/> |
| 339 | + </if> |
| 340 | + </choose> |
329 | 341 | </if>
|
330 |
| - <else> |
331 |
| - <text variable="archive" prefix="[" suffix="]"/> |
332 |
| - </else> |
333 | 342 | </choose>
|
334 | 343 | </macro>
|
335 | 344 | <macro name="quoted">
|
336 | 345 | <group prefix="[" suffix="]">
|
337 |
| - <text term="accessed" form="short" suffix=". "/> |
| 346 | + <text term="accessed" form="short" suffix=" "/> |
338 | 347 | <date variable="accessed">
|
339 |
| - <date-part name="day" suffix=". "/> |
340 |
| - <date-part name="month" suffix=". " form="numeric"/> |
| 348 | + <date-part name="day" suffix=". "/> |
| 349 | + <date-part name="month" suffix=". " form="numeric"/> |
341 | 350 | <date-part name="year"/>
|
342 | 351 | </date>
|
343 | 352 | </group>
|
|
357 | 366 | <else-if position="subsequent">
|
358 | 367 | <text macro="contributors-short" suffix=". "/>
|
359 | 368 | <text macro="title-short" font-style="italic"/>
|
| 369 | + <choose> |
| 370 | + <if variable="author" match="none"> |
| 371 | + <text prefix=", " macro="issued-year"/> |
| 372 | + </if> |
| 373 | + </choose> |
360 | 374 | <text macro="locator-or-period"/>
|
361 | 375 | </else-if>
|
362 | 376 | <else>
|
|
367 | 381 | <text macro="container"/>
|
368 | 382 | <text prefix=". " variable="volume" text-case="capitalize-first"/>
|
369 | 383 | <choose>
|
370 |
| - <if variable="accessed DOI URL" match="any"> |
| 384 | + <if variable="URL" match="any"> |
371 | 385 | <text prefix=". " macro="issued"/>
|
372 | 386 | <text prefix=", " macro="citation-locator"/>
|
373 | 387 | <text prefix=" " macro="quoted"/>
|
374 |
| - <text prefix=". " macro="identifier" suffix="."/> |
| 388 | + <text prefix=". " macro="identifier"/> |
375 | 389 | </if>
|
376 | 390 | <else-if variable="issued" match="none">
|
377 | 391 | <choose>
|
|
400 | 414 | </choose>
|
401 | 415 | <text macro="container"/>
|
402 | 416 | <choose>
|
403 |
| - <if variable="accessed DOI URL" match="any"> |
| 417 | + <if variable="URL" match="any"> |
404 | 418 | <text prefix=". " macro="issued"/>
|
405 | 419 | <text prefix=", " macro="citation-locator"/>
|
406 | 420 | <text prefix=" " macro="quoted"/>
|
407 |
| - <text prefix=". " macro="identifier" suffix="."/> |
| 421 | + <text prefix=". " macro="identifier"/> |
408 | 422 | </if>
|
409 | 423 | <else>
|
410 | 424 | <text prefix=". " macro="issued"/>
|
|
418 | 432 | <text macro="container"/>
|
419 | 433 | <text prefix=". " macro="issued"/>
|
420 | 434 | <choose>
|
421 |
| - <if variable="accessed DOI URL" match="any"> |
| 435 | + <if variable="URL" match="any"> |
422 | 436 | <text prefix=", " macro="citation-locator"/>
|
423 | 437 | <text prefix=" " macro="quoted"/>
|
424 |
| - <text prefix=". " macro="identifier" suffix="."/> |
| 438 | + <text prefix=". " macro="identifier"/> |
425 | 439 | </if>
|
426 | 440 | <else>
|
427 | 441 | <text macro="locator-or-period"/>
|
|
442 | 456 | <text macro="title-long" font-style="italic"/>
|
443 | 457 | <text prefix=" " macro="medium"/>
|
444 | 458 | <choose>
|
445 |
| - <if variable="accessed DOI URL" match="any"> |
| 459 | + <if variable="URL" match="any"> |
446 | 460 | <text prefix=". " macro="issued"/>
|
447 | 461 | <text prefix=", " macro="citation-locator"/>
|
448 | 462 | <text prefix=" " macro="quoted"/>
|
449 |
| - <text prefix=". " macro="identifier" suffix="."/> |
| 463 | + <text prefix=". " macro="identifier"/> |
450 | 464 | </if>
|
451 | 465 | <else-if variable="issued" match="none">
|
452 | 466 | <choose>
|
|
494 | 508 | <text macro="container-full"/>
|
495 | 509 | <text prefix=". " variable="volume" text-case="capitalize-first"/>
|
496 | 510 | <choose>
|
497 |
| - <if variable="accessed DOI URL" match="any"> |
| 511 | + <if variable="URL" match="any"> |
498 | 512 | <text prefix=". " macro="edition"/>
|
499 | 513 | <text prefix=". " macro="issued"/>
|
500 | 514 | <text prefix=", " macro="page-range"/>
|
501 | 515 | <text prefix=" " macro="quoted"/>
|
502 | 516 | <text prefix=". " macro="collection" suffix="."/>
|
503 |
| - <text prefix=". " macro="identifier" suffix="."/> |
| 517 | + <text prefix=". " macro="identifier"/> |
504 | 518 | </if>
|
505 | 519 | <else-if variable="issued" match="none">
|
506 | 520 | <text prefix=". " macro="edition" suffix="."/>
|
|
536 | 550 | <text macro="container-full"/>
|
537 | 551 | <text prefix=". " macro="issued"/>
|
538 | 552 | <choose>
|
539 |
| - <if variable="accessed DOI URL" match="any"> |
| 553 | + <if variable="URL" match="any"> |
540 | 554 | <text prefix=", " macro="page-range"/>
|
541 | 555 | <text prefix=" " macro="quoted"/>
|
542 |
| - <text prefix=". " macro="identifier" suffix="."/> |
| 556 | + <text prefix=". " macro="identifier"/> |
543 | 557 | </if>
|
544 | 558 | <else>
|
545 | 559 | <text prefix=", " macro="page-range" suffix="."/>
|
|
552 | 566 | <text macro="container-full"/>
|
553 | 567 | <text prefix=". " macro="issued"/>
|
554 | 568 | <choose>
|
555 |
| - <if variable="accessed DOI URL" match="any"> |
| 569 | + <if variable="URL" match="any"> |
556 | 570 | <text prefix=", " macro="page-range"/>
|
557 | 571 | <text prefix=" " macro="quoted"/>
|
558 |
| - <text prefix=". " macro="identifier" suffix="."/> |
| 572 | + <text prefix=". " macro="identifier"/> |
559 | 573 | </if>
|
560 | 574 | <else>
|
561 | 575 | <text prefix=", " macro="page-range" suffix="."/>
|
|
570 | 584 | <text prefix=", " variable="genre"/>
|
571 | 585 | <text prefix=", " variable="publisher" suffix="."/>
|
572 | 586 | </else-if>
|
573 |
| - <else> |
| 587 | + <else-if type="bill legal_case legislation" match="none"> |
574 | 588 | <text macro="contributors-full" suffix=". "/>
|
575 | 589 | <text macro="title-long" font-style="italic"/>
|
576 | 590 | <choose>
|
577 |
| - <if variable="accessed DOI URL" match="any"> |
| 591 | + <if variable="URL" match="any"> |
578 | 592 | <text prefix=" " macro="medium"/>
|
579 | 593 | <text prefix=". " macro="secondary-contributors"/>
|
580 | 594 | <text prefix=". " macro="edition" suffix="."/>
|
581 | 595 | <text prefix=". " macro="issued"/>
|
582 | 596 | <text prefix=" " macro="quoted" suffix="."/>
|
583 | 597 | <text prefix=". " macro="collection" suffix="."/>
|
584 |
| - <text prefix=". " macro="identifier" suffix="."/> |
| 598 | + <text prefix=". " macro="identifier"/> |
585 | 599 | </if>
|
586 | 600 | <else-if variable="issued" match="none">
|
587 | 601 | <text prefix=" " macro="medium" suffix="."/>
|
|
599 | 613 | <text prefix=". " macro="collection" suffix="."/>
|
600 | 614 | </else>
|
601 | 615 | </choose>
|
602 |
| - </else> |
| 616 | + </else-if> |
603 | 617 | </choose>
|
604 | 618 | </layout>
|
605 | 619 | </bibliography>
|
|
0 commit comments